Purpose and description of the content of education: | In the second-degree physics studies, the subject "Machine Learning" provides an introduction to advanced methods of data analysis and artificial intelligence in the context of physics. The aim of this course is to acquaint students with the latest machine learning techniques and their applications in physics.
During the classes, various machine learning techniques are discussed, including regression, classification, and clustering models. Students also learn about deep neural networks, methods for dimensionality reduction of data, and model optimization.
Special emphasis is placed on practical applications in physics, such as data analysis from large-scale physical experiments, forecasting experimental results, or discovering hidden patterns in measurement data.
This subject enables students to enhance their analytical skills and gain practical experience in utilizing advanced machine learning techniques in the context of physics. |
